Catriona Crombie is a scholar working on Molecular Biology, Aging and Pathology and Forensic Medicine. According to data from OpenAlex, Catriona Crombie has authored 8 papers receiving a total of 797 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 5 papers in Aging and 1 paper in Pathology and Forensic Medicine. Recurrent topics in Catriona Crombie's work include Genetics, Aging, and Longevity in Model Organisms (5 papers), CRISPR and Genetic Engineering (3 papers) and Bioinformatics and Genomic Networks (2 papers). Catriona Crombie is often cited by papers focused on Genetics, Aging, and Longevity in Model Organisms (5 papers), CRISPR and Genetic Engineering (3 papers) and Bioinformatics and Genomic Networks (2 papers). Catriona Crombie collaborates with scholars based in United Kingdom, United States and Switzerland. Catriona Crombie's co-authors include Andrew Fraser, Ben Lehner, Angelo Fortunato, Julia Tischler, Wendy S W Wong, Edward M. Marcotte, Insuk Lee, Jonathan Pettitt, Daniel Schümperli and Berndt Müller and has published in prestigious journals such as The Lancet, Nature Genetics and The EMBO Journal.
